Print Umruf 3 is a regular weight, very narrow, low contrast, italic, short x-height font.

A compact, right-leaning handwritten print with smooth, brush-like strokes and rounded terminals. Letterforms are narrow and lively, with gently irregular widths and a flowing baseline rhythm that keeps the texture informal without becoming messy. Curves and loops are prominent in both capitals and lowercase, and the overall construction favors simplified, continuous shapes over sharp corners. Numerals follow the same rounded, handwritten logic and sit comfortably with the letters in color and spacing.
Well suited to branding accents, packaging, menus, posters, and social graphics where a personable handwritten voice is desired. It works best for short to medium text—titles, pull quotes, labels, and captions—where its narrow, lively rhythm can add character without overwhelming the layout.
The font feels warm and approachable, with a cheerful, conversational tone. Its energetic slant and buoyant curves suggest spontaneity and a personal note, while the consistent stroke weight keeps it readable and friendly rather than dramatic.
Designed to capture an informal brush-pen note in a clean, printable form, balancing expressive loops and a consistent stroke so it can be used as a friendly display script for everyday design contexts.
Capitals are expressive and slightly embellished, helping them stand out as initial caps and short headings. The lowercase maintains a compact footprint and a steady cadence, giving paragraphs a casual, note-like texture while still reading clearly at moderate sizes.
